Breathe Easy : Improving Indoor Air Quality for Health
Wiki Article
The air we breathe indoors can greatly influence our well-being. Poor indoor air quality leads to a range of concerns, from allergies and headaches to more serious respiratory ailments. Fortunately, there are several steps we can take to guarantee cleaner, healthier air in our homes.
To begin with open windows regularly to allow fresh air to circulate and remove stale air. Consider using an air purifier to filter out airborne particles such as pollen, dust mites, and pet dander. Additionally, maintaining a clean living environment by frequently dusting can greatly lessen indoor air pollution.
Finally, be mindful of common household products that produce volatile organic compounds (VOCs), such as paints, cleaners, and air fresheners. Choose natural alternatives whenever possible to reduce exposure to these potentially harmful substances.
By adopting these simple steps, you can create a healthier indoor environment and breathe easy.
